This is a technical meeting to discuss how to provide nutrient reduction credits for non-traditional type water quality improvement projects that benefit the Indian River Lagoon and help meet the nutrient loading reductions required by Total Maximum Daily Loads. The Indian River Lagoon Total Maximum Daily Loads were adopted in March 2009 and require reductions in the loadings of total nitrogen and total phosphorus to the Lagoon sufficient for recovery of deep-water seagrass habitat. Project types that will be discussed at the meeting include the removal of muck deposits, aquatic plant harvesting, and changes in type and operation of water control structures.
